I was skeptical about the pro’s and con’s of Cushcore like a lot of people that haven’t ridden a bike with them installed. Then I tried them in my bike park bike…..Everything that cushcore claims to be, lives up to those claims. The ride dampening and benefits of lower pressures is obvious as soon as you start ripping the trails, the added weight from the inserts is negligible compared to how much this improved my ride feel. After a year of bike park use on that bike, I now have cushcore in all my bikes :D

As a larger rider (I'm big boned...) kitted I'm 6'2" 260, the support these give the tire sidewall is worth the price alone. Allowing some slightly lower tire pressure is huge for me too not only in increased traction but it doesn't sacrifice compliance. Another huge advantage is the vibration dampening; washboard, roots, rocks and such are much less transferred into my hands. Just get them, they are bad@ss.

The CushCore Pro Kit is a foam insert that sits inside a mountain bike tyre against the rim to prevent pinch flats, acting as an awesome damper and reducing the sudden unwanted spring back that you get from normal pneumatic tyres. It does this by dividing the inner volume of the tyre in half, with air underneath the tread as normal, and the CushCore insert next to the rim. The CushCore absorbs shock to protect your rim from sudden impacts and preventing pinch flats and support sidewalls to eliminate excessive tyre roll in corners, so that you can run lighter tyres for aggressive riding. It also acts as a mechanical bead lock, anchoring the bead inside the rim so that tyre burping is highly unlikely. Designed to be used with tubeless-ready or tubeless converted mountain bike rims and tyres, it is made to be waterproof, compatible with tubeless tyre sealant, and tuned for an appropriate rebound feel. Unlike most puncture protection systems, the foam will last longer than a single impact. The ability to withstand repeated impacts without damage is typical of far heavier foams, giving this kit a significant edge. Features CushCore is compatible with tubeless tyres and rims Fits tyre widths 2.1. 2.6" Fits rims with internal width 22 - 35mm Non tubeless-ready rims will require rim tape Tubeless tyre seal and is recommended to be used with CushCore Installation with certain tyre and wheel combinations may require 2 people - one to work the tyre levers and another to hold the tyre bead in the drop centre of the rim. wire bead downhill tyres are most likely to need extra help CushCore weighs as much as a standard butyl inner tube 29" inserts 260 grams.
